Trivia:
The police cruisers seen during the finale were real Houston Police squad cars. Ford LTD Crown Victorias were used by HPD from 1983 - 1987; the last use of these squads was in 1993. more

A black comedy of conflict between two hit men and a boy., 30 April 2006
10/10
Author: davidddt from Scotland UK

I cannot understand why this movie has not been given better reviews. One of those films which surprises you with its originality and which having seen it you cannot understand why it has not been given more screen time.

Brilliant professional acting between Baldwin and Scheider keeps you guessing till the end as to who is going to win the battle of wills between the two men and the boy. A terrific black comedy of errors which makes you feel almost sorry for the two hit men. It would be a mistake not to watch this movie simply because you have read the bad reviews of it on this site.

It deserves to be released worldwide on DVD.
